> CLI command for update CredentialReference should fail rather then pass.
> Because CLI command doesn't persist any data to configuration file but pass.
> I expect that command would fail and shows some error message.
> *How to reproduce*
> {code}
> /subsystem=elytron/credential-store=credS004:add(uri="cr-store://test/credS004.jceks?create.storage=true", credential-reference={clear-text=pass987}, relative-to=jboss.server.data.dir)
> {code}
> {code}
> /subsystem=elytron/credential-store=credS004:write-attribute(name=credential-reference.store, value=credS002)
> {code}
> *AND*
> {code}
> /subsystem=elytron/credential-store=credS004:write-attribute(name=credential-reference.alias, value=credS002)
> {code}
> *Ends with success, but it has to be a failure*
> These commands could lead to inconsistency.
> Because there is valid state to have
> credential-reference={clear-text=pass987}
> and credential-reference={store=cs, alias=alias}
> but not their combination.
> *I can use this right form of command*
> {code}
> /subsystem=elytron/credential-store=credS004:write-attribute(name=credential-reference, value={store=credS002, alias=jimmy})
> {code}
> Now is everything OK.
